Massey Ferguson B.00.22 – Autotronic 5 - Transmission 1 controller (CAB151): Issue With Calibration OF Valves
Issue description
This code indicates that the transmission's electro-hydraulic valves (specifically the Power Shuttle or transmission shift valves) are out of calibration, or a recent calibration attempt has failed. This can cause jerky shifting, delayed direction changes, or a complete lack of shuttle response.

Check the cause
Check transmission oil temperature via the Dash Control Center (diagnostic screen 1) to ensure it is between 35°C (95°F) and 45°C (113°F).
Perform a valve warm-up by engaging the PTO and activating the PowerShuttle forward and reverse 10 times in each direction, holding for 5-10 seconds each time.
Verify PowerShuttle progressivity settings (forward engagement, reverse engagement, and ratio shifting sensitivity) are all set to '0' on the dash screen.
Check the shuttle position potentiometer (located on the transmission cover on the right-hand side) for correct voltage and physical adjustment.
